General Information
Title: Hosianna dem Sohne Davids
Composer: Anonymous
Number of voices: 5vv Voicing: SSATB
Genre: Sacred, Motet
Language: German
Instruments: A cappella

Original text and translations
German text
Hosianna dem Sohne Davids!
Gelobet sei, der da kommt im Namen des Herren.
Hosianna in der Höhe!
